Kaduna State Government Declares Free Education For Secondary School Girls

Kaduna State Government has declared free education for secondary school girls in the state, a move meant to increase female enrollment.

This was revealed on Friday by the Commissioner for Education, Science, and Technology, Ja’afaru Sani in Kaduna.

According to Sani, “The Ministry of Education has sent a directive to that effect to all zonal offices and secondary schools for implementation.

“Before now, only the primary school children were enjoying the free education in the state but the governor has decided to include girls in the secondary school so that they can also benefit from free education.”

Already, the state has free education for all gender at the primary school level in line with Governor Nasir El-Rufai administration’s policy on education.

The commissioner also noted that the newly-recruited teachers in the state will get the backlog of their payments by the end of the month.
